Contribution to Vehicle Electrification
Introducing electrified products utilizing JATCO's proprietary technologies
As a CVT and AT manufacturer, JATCO has delivered over 130 million units to the market. Meanwhile, for more than 10 years, JATCO has been accumulating know-how in preparation for the era of electrification.
In 2010, we developed the JR712E, the world’s first transmission for RWD hybrid vehicles that uses a one-motor, two-clutch system. Furthermore, we have started supplying motors and gearboxes for electric vehicles. From 2025, to launch the X-in-1, which integrates gears, a motor, and an inverter, we have established our first production base in Europe in the UK and launched a production line at the Fuji Area. 3-in-1 for electric vehicles
The 3-in-1 will be installed in the new Nissan LEAF, scheduled for market launch in FY2025, and will enable efficient energy management and superior driving performance.
5-in-1 for e-POWER
The 5-in-1 is the central electric unit responsible for the high performance of the third-generation e-POWER. It is scheduled to be installed in the European Qashqai in the second half of FY2025, followed by the next-generation Rogue in North America and the all-new Elgrand for the Japanese market in FY2026.

Production bases are also being steadily prepared
JATCO UK Ltd
JATCO UK Ltd, announced in January 2025, has been established in Sunderland and is scheduled to begin supplying the 3-in-1 to Nissanʼs UK base starting in 2026. JATCO UK Ltd will be JATCOʼs first production base in Europe.
e-Powertrain plant
We have renovated the plant in the Fuji Area that had been producing automatic transmissions and made it the independent e-Powertrain Plant starting in FY2025. This plant will serve as a global mother plant and become an important base for the worldwide deployment of the technological capabilities cultivated in the Fuji Area.

Challenge of achieving high power density(downsizing)
Achieving high power density in e-Axles goes beyond mere downsizing. It enables vehicle weight reduction and efficient use of resources while significantly enhancing design flexibility in vehicle development. With the transition to electric vehicles, an increase in vehicle weight due to battery installation is inevitable. This weight increase requires greater driving force depending on the vehicle type, increasing the need to install e-Axles on both front and rear axles. Achieving high power density in e-Axles also provides a solution to this challenge.
